Detachable office table
By incorporating casters and a push rod system at the bottom of the bookcase, the inconvenience of rotating the bookcase in traditional detachable desks is resolved, enabling convenient rotation and orientation fixation of the bookcase, thus improving its stability and portability.

AI Technical Summary
Traditional detachable desks are difficult to rotate when turning the bookcase, requiring the main tabletop to be lifted or the bookcase angle to be fixed, which affects usability.
The bottom of the bookcase is equipped with casters. The positioning block is driven to abut against the connecting shaft by the push rod and the telescopic rod to fix the angle of the bookcase. The casters enable smooth rotation. The push rod slides in the support plate for stable movement. The table legs are detachable for storage.
It enables the bookshelf to be easily rotated and its orientation fixed, reducing the need to adjust the desk and improving stability and portability.

TECHNICAL FIELD
[0001] The present application relates to the technical field of office furniture, in particular to a detachable office table. BACKGROUND
[0002] With the increasing compactness of office space and the growing demand for personalization, traditional fixed office desks have been unable to meet the diverse use scenarios. Although various types of folding or portable desks have appeared on the market, they are usually large in size, inconvenient to carry or complex in structure and difficult to assemble. These factors limit the flexibility and convenience of users.
[0003] The existing patent (announcement number: CN221887866U) discloses a detachable office table, which belongs to the technical field of furniture and comprises a main table board and a bookcase. The main table board is movably provided with an extension table board that can expand the use area of the office table. The extension table board and the main table board are detachably arranged. A roller shaft one is rotatably arranged at the bottom of one end of the main table board. The roller shaft one rolls on the top surface of the extension table board. One end of the extension table board is also rotatably connected to the bookcase. The main table board and the extension table board can be detached and installed. The extension table board can be displaced in the sliding sleeve. On the one hand, the use area of the table top can be increased by displacement. In home use, the appropriate area of the table top can also be adjusted according to the actual placement scene of the study. On the other hand, the extension table board is easy to detach. After detachment, the two table tops are easy to carry.
[0004] The above-mentioned scheme has the following problems: the bookcase is directly placed on the ground, which is relatively laborious when rotating the bookcase. Even the main table board above the bookcase needs to be lifted upwards to rotate the bookcase. Moreover, the angle of the bookcase cannot be fixed, and the bookcase will rotate under external impact, affecting the use of the bookcase. Practical new type content
[0005] In view of the deficiencies of the prior art, the present application provides a detachable office table, which has the advantages of being able to conveniently rotate the bookcase, without the need for excessive adjustment of the office table before rotating the bookcase, and being able to fix the orientation of the bookcase after adjusting the orientation of the bookcase. The problems of the bookcase being directly placed on the ground, being relatively laborious when rotating the bookcase, even needing to lift the main table board above the bookcase upwards to rotate the bookcase, and being unable to fix the angle of the bookcase, which will rotate under external impact, affecting the use of the bookcase, are solved.
[0006] To achieve the above-mentioned can be convenient to rotate the bookcase, without adjusting the office desk before rotating the bookcase, and after adjusting the orientation of the bookcase, the orientation of the bookcase can be fixed, the application provides the following technical scheme: a detachable office table, including a main table board, the bottom of one end of the main table board is provided with a sliding sleeve, the inner wall of the middle part of the sliding sleeve is inserted with an extension table board, the bottom of the extension table board is provided with a connecting shaft, the connecting shaft is slidingly arranged in the inner wall of the middle part of the positioning sleeve, the bottom of the inner wall of the positioning sleeve is provided with a plane bearing, the bottom of the positioning sleeve is arranged in the inner wall of the bottom of the connecting frame, the bottom of the connecting frame is provided with a bookcase, the bottom of the bookcase is provided with a universal wheel at each corner, the inner wall of one end of the connecting frame is rotatably provided with a rotating wheel through a rotating shaft, the outer surface of the middle part of the rotating wheel is provided with a push block on one side, the outer surface of one end of the push block is slidingly connected with the outer surface of one side of the push plate, the other side of the push plate is arranged on one end of the push rod, the other end of the push rod is provided with a telescopic rod, the telescopic rod is provided with a positioning block at one end, the positioning block is located on one side of the connecting shaft, the shape of the outer surface of one side of the positioning block is matched with the shape of the outer surface of the middle part of the connecting shaft, the side of the positioning block away from the telescopic rod is made of anti-skid rubber material, and the bottom of the other end of the main table board is provided with two mounting sleeves, and the inner wall of the middle part of the two mounting sleeves is screwed with two table legs.
[0007] Through the above scheme, the universal wheel arranged at the bottom of the bookcase enables the bookcase to rotate smoothly, the push rod pushes the telescopic rod to move, the telescopic rod drives the positioning block to abut against the outer surface of the middle part of the connecting shaft, the anti-skid rubber surface on one side of the positioning block is fixed to the connecting shaft, the angle between the bookcase and the connecting shaft is fixed, and the effect of conveniently rotating the bookcase, without adjusting the office desk before rotating the bookcase, and fixing the orientation of the bookcase after adjusting the orientation of the bookcase is achieved.
[0008] Further, the outer surface of the middle part of the push rod is slidingly arranged in the inner wall of the middle part of the supporting plate, and the bottom of the supporting plate is arranged on the bottom of the inner wall of the middle part of the connecting frame.
[0009] Through the above scheme, the outer surface of the middle part of the push rod is slidingly arranged in the inner wall of the middle part of the supporting plate, the trajectory of the push rod during movement can be fixed, and the stability of the push rod during movement is improved.
[0010] Further, a first spring is arranged between the push plate and the supporting plate, one end of the first spring is arranged on one side of the push plate, and the other end of the first spring is arranged on one side of the supporting plate.
[0011] Through the above scheme, the push plate can be pushed away from the supporting plate by the arrangement of the first spring, the push rod is driven to move, the push rod drives the positioning block away from the connecting shaft through the telescopic rod, and the positioning block and the connecting shaft are released from the restriction on the angle of the bookcase.
[0012] Further, the telescopic rod is internally provided with a second spring, one end of the second spring is arranged on one end of the inner wall of the telescopic outer tube of the telescopic rod, and the other end of the second spring is arranged on one end of the telescopic inner rod.
[0013] Through the above scheme, the telescopic rod can smoothly drive the positioning block to move through the arrangement of the second spring inside the telescopic rod, and the telescopic rod can stably push the positioning block through the arrangement of the second spring, so that the positioning block can stably abut against the connecting shaft.
[0014] Further, one side of the outer surface of the rotating wheel is provided with a lever, and one end of the lever is inclined.
[0015] Through the above scheme, the rotating wheel can be conveniently driven to rotate through the arrangement of the lever, and the angle of the pushing block can be adjusted, and the inclined arrangement of one end of the lever can conveniently drive the lever.
[0016] Further, the table leg comprises a first supporting leg and a second supporting leg, and the inner wall of one end of the first supporting leg is threadedly connected with the outer surface of one end of the second supporting leg.
[0017] Through the above scheme, the first supporting leg and the second supporting leg can be disassembled through the threaded connection therebetween, so as to further shorten the length of the table leg, and the table leg can be conveniently stored when the office table is disassembled, so as to avoid that the excessively long table leg affects the storage of the table leg.
[0018] Further, the outer surface of the middle part of the push rod is quadrangular, and the shape of the outer surface of the middle part of the push rod is matched with the shape of the inner wall of the middle part of the supporting plate.
[0019] Through the above scheme, the angle of the push rod during movement can be fixed through the quadrangular arrangement of the outer surface of the middle part of the push rod matched with the shape of the inner wall of the middle part of the supporting plate, so as to fix the angle of the positioning block during movement, so that the positioning block can stably abut against the connecting shaft at a fixed angle.
[0020] Further, the bottom of the table leg is provided with a non-slip pad.
[0021] Through the above scheme, the non-slip pad arranged at the bottom of the table leg can improve the non-slip property of the table leg, so as to improve the stability of the office table during use.

[0042] The working principle of the above embodiment is that when it is needed to increase the desktop use area of the office table, the extension desktop plate 3 is pulled to slide in the sliding sleeve 2, so that the extension desktop plate 3 extends to the outside of one end of the main desktop plate 1, and meanwhile the extension desktop plate 3 drives the bookcase 8 to move through the cooperation of the connecting shaft 4 and the positioning sleeve 5, so as to increase the desktop use area of the office table; when it is needed to adjust the angle of the bookcase 8, the lever 17 is pulled to drive the rotating wheel 9 to rotate counterclockwise, the rotating wheel 9 drives the push block 10 to swing, the push block 10 gradually releases the pushing of the push plate 11, the first spring 15 starts to gradually release the pushing force, the push plate 11 gradually moves away from the supporting plate 20, the push plate 11 drives the push rod 12 to move, the push rod 12 drives the positioning block 14 to gradually release the abutment with the positioning block 14 through the telescopic rod 13, and then the positioning block 14 and the connecting shaft 4 release the limitation of the angle of the bookcase 8 through the positioning block 14, the bookcase 8 is turned through the universal wheel 21 at the bottom of the extension desktop plate 3, and the angle of the bookcase 8 is adjusted; when it is needed to fix the angle of the bookcase 8, the lever 17 is pulled to drive the rotating wheel 9 to rotate clockwise, the push block 10 pushes the push plate 11 to move to the supporting plate 20, and then the push rod 12 cooperates with the telescopic rod 13 to drive the positioning block 14 to abut against the connecting shaft 4, so as to fix the angle of the bookcase 8; when it is needed to disassemble the office table, the lever 17 and the rotating wheel 9 are operated to release the abutment of the positioning block 14 and the connecting shaft 4, the table leg 19 is turned to rotate out of the mounting sleeve 18, and then the table leg 19 is separated from the main desktop plate 1, the extension desktop plate 3 is pulled out of the sliding sleeve 2, the extension desktop plate 3 is separated from the main desktop plate 1, the extension desktop plate 3 is pulled up from the top of the connecting frame 7, the connecting shaft 4 is pulled out of the positioning sleeve 5, the extension desktop plate 3 is separated from the bookcase 8, the first supporting leg 191 and the second supporting leg 192 are turned to be separated from each other, and the disassembly of the office table is completed.
